Singer Adekunle Gold recounts how music took him globally

Popular musician Adekunle Gold has inspired fans with his heartfelt success tale of his first trip outside of Nigeria.

In a widely shared video, the singer said that the first time he traveled outside of Nigeria was in 2015, and it was due of a song called “Shade.” He also had the name “Orente” during the time.

Since then, he has traveled to over 35 countries, driven by his enthusiasm.

He encouraged and prayed for his fans and followers to never give up on their enthusiasm because it would undoubtedly lead to their success.

His words: “The first time I ever traveled out of Nigeria was in 2015. Guess what took me out? One song, “Shade.” I had “Shade” and “Orente” then. And since then, I think I’ve been to 35 countries.

“I say this to say, your passion, the one thing that you love to do will make way for you. I always wanted to travel as a child but where I see the money.

“But look, I’m just praying for you guys that you find something, you know, that will take you places and if you have already found it, just keep at it. You will go places.”
